I am a 57 year old female who recently had a colonoscopy. The results stated I have Colitis and diverticulosis of the sigmoid colon.The only symptoms prior to the test were intermittent diarrhea and pain in my left side. I go for my follow-up in in a week with my Dr. Should I watch my diet and what else should I be aware of?

Typically high fiber diet is advisable for diverticulosis, however since this has presented as an acute episode of in inflammation, a high fiber diet is best avoided till the inflammation subsides. I would suggest keeping the diet soft with plenty of fluids along with the medications prescribed by your doctor, for the time being.
